Cryo-EM Structure of Chicken Gizzard Smooth Muscle alpha-Actinin

Template:ABSTRACT PUBMED 15050827

About this Structure

1SJJ is a 2 chains structure of sequences from Gallus gallus. Full crystallographic information is available from OCA.
